f
finger ·phrase (IDIOM)
Definition: to hope that things will happen in the way that you want them to Level: C2
f
finger ·phrase
Definition: to be/stay familiar with the most recent changes or improvements Level: C2
f
finger ·phrase (IDIOM)
Definition: to understand exactly why a situation is the way it is Level: C2